I’ll start with the code:
var s = ["hi"];
console.log(s);
s[0] = "bye";
console.log(s);
Simple, right? In response to this, the Firefox console says:
[ "hi" ]
[ "bye" ]
Wonderful, but Chrome’s JavaScript console (7.0.517.41 beta) says:
[ "bye" ]
[ "bye" ]
Have I done something wrong, or is Chrome’s JavaScript console being exceptionally lazy about evaluating my array?
Thanks for the comment, tec. I was able to find an existing unconfirmed Webkit bug that explains this issue: https://bugs.webkit.org/show_bug.cgi?id=35801 (EDIT: now fixed!)
There appears to be some debate regarding just how much of a bug it is and whether it's fixable. It does seem like bad behavior to me. It was especially troubling to me because, in Chrome at least, it occurs when the code resides in scripts that are executed immediately (before the page is loaded), even when the console is open, whenever the page is refreshed. Calling console.log when the console is not yet active only results in a reference to the object being queued, not the output the console will contain. Therefore, the array (or any object), will not be evaluated until the console is ready. It really is a case of lazy evaluation.
However, there is a simple way to avoid this in your code:
var s = ["hi"];
console.log(s.toString());
s[0] = "bye";
console.log(s.toString());
By calling toString, you create a representation in memory that will not be altered by following statements, which the console will read when it is ready. The console output is slightly different from passing the object directly, but it seems acceptable:
hi
bye
From Eric's explanation, it is due to console.log() being queued up, and it prints a later value of the array (or object).
There can be 5 solutions:
1. arr.toString() // not well for [1,[2,3]] as it shows 1,2,3
2. arr.join() // same as above
3. arr.slice(0) // a new array is created, but if arr is [1, 2, arr2, 3]
// and arr2 changes, then later value might be shown
4. arr.concat() // a new array is created, but same issue as slice(0)
5. JSON.stringify(arr) // works well as it takes a snapshot of the whole array
// or object, and the format shows the exact structure

the shortest solution so far is to use array or object spread syntax to get a clone of values to be preserved as in time of logging, ie:
console.log({...myObject});
console.log([...myArray]);
however be warned as it does a shallow copy, so any deep nested non-primitive values will not be cloned and thus shown in their modified state in the console

At first: well, protractor does, what you told it to do... You may read a bit about promises and async JavaScript.
I try to explain a bit, please understand, that explaining everything would take a lot of time.
Starting protractor calls your script (spec). The most lines you wrote before calling getArrayList() are function calls which return promises. This means, the function is called, and when ready, it's callback function gets called (e.g.: then(...))
An example:
var colCount = element.all(by.repeater('col in renderedColumns')).count();
colCount.then(console.log) // This prints '80'
In this two lines you are searching the DOM for every element which can be located by col in renderedColumns, then, if ready, count them and return the value to its callback then, afterwards print it via console.log.
But all of this takes time, and this is the reason why console.log('Array List function started'); gets printed before colCount.then(console.log).
Hope I could help a bit, as mentioned before, you may read a bit about promises.
